This was one of the greatest dramas ever produced for television. It featured John Housman as the famed contract law Professor Charles W. Kingsfield, who was both idolized and feared by his students for his no-nonsense approach to teaching and learning. Several people that I know who went to law school, were actually stunned by the realistic acting and the dramatic tension of the series. This wonderful drama was based on the great 1973 theatrical movie of the same name. John Housman was absolutely brilliant in his role as the demanding professor. Even more interesting was that the cases discussed in the series where actual legal cases. I learned that the series itself was filmed at Harvard Law School. (The writers on the series worked with the particulars of legal issues with actual lawyers to maintain realism in the show.) The only thing was, when the series ran on CBS it only ran for one season (The fall of 1978) PBS picked it up and reran it in the summer of 1979. Showtime picked it up for the 1984-1986 season with new episodes. The pay service got rave reviews for it, using the same main charactors as the original series. (Except it had taken them 8 "years" to graduate from law school instead of the traditional three years!)
